1. Worldwide CO2 emissions increased 6% in 2010.
2. China’s emissions were 50% greater than the U.S. last year.
3. “. . . the latest figures put global emissions higher than the worst case projections from the [IPCC]”.
Yikes, people. That means more than an 11 degree F increase in average global temperature by the end of the century.
